Heavy Equipment for Ground Compaction

When it comes to building a solid foundation or laying down durable roadways, compaction is paramount. Material needs to be properly compressed to ensure stability and prevent future settling or shifting. This is where compactors come into play as indispensable tools in the construction industry. Heavy-duty equipment utilize force to densely pack down soil, gravel, asphalt, or other materials, creating a stable base for structures and pavement.

  • Plate compactors are commonly used for smaller areas like foundations and driveways, while drum rollers are preferred for larger road projects.
  • Selecting appropriate equipment depends on factors such as project size, soil type, and desired compaction level.
